The opportunity

Altruist is seeking a Senior Sales Executive for our Enterprise team to own and navigate qualified opportunities from discovery through successful onboarding. This role requires a seller who can deeply understand prospect priorities, articulate our platform's value, and build compelling business cases that drive action through a kind, confident, and  consultative approach. You will lead the account strategy, identify the real champions and skeptics, and align internal teams to move complex deals forward with credibility and a sense of urgency. In this capacity, you will own high-level deal strategy, account plans, executive relationships, negotiation, and the process discipline necessary to repeatedly close Enterprise accounts.

Your impact

  • Own a portfolio of large, complex enterprise opportunities and lead them from discovery through onboarding.
  • Act as the leader for your deals, coordinating closely with Business Development, Solutions Engineering, Relationship Management, Product, Operations, Trading, Marketing, and Support.
  • Build and maintain detailed account plans, deal notes, internal next steps, and external action plans that keep complex opportunities organized and moving.
  • Lead multi-threaded deal strategy across executive, operational, and advisor stakeholders, identifying who is truly driving the deal, who still needs to buy in, and where hidden resistance may exist.
  • Run thoughtful business-case and solution-alignment conversations that connect Altruist’s platform, pricing, service model, and roadmap to the prospect’s real operating and growth priorities.
  • Maintain calm, credible communication with prospects when there are product gaps, commercial complexities, or implementation questions, while pulling in internal partners to define pragmatic paths forward.
  • Partner with internal teams on commercial structuring, pricing discussions, and proposal development for strategic firms where standard motions are not sufficient.
  • Help improve the Enterprise operating system by regularly iterating on playbooks, sales process, account-plan quality, and deal communication across the organization.
  • Maintain strong Salesforce hygiene, stage management, and deal inspection rigor so the team can forecast accurately and improve stage velocity, close rate, and opportunity quality over time.
  • Travel as needed for onsite visits, executive meetings, strategic presentations, and critical late-stage deal moments.

What you bring

  • 10+ years of enterprise sales, strategic account management, or complex client-facing experience in wealth management, fintech, custody, or adjacent financial services.
  • Strong grasp of the RIA ecosystem, including advisor business models, custody dynamics, operational workflows, and the realities of selling into large, multi-stakeholder firms.
  • Proven ability to move complex opportunities through solution alignment, business case, onsite diligence, and commit stages toward a signed proposal.
  • Excellent judgment in stakeholder mapping. You know how to identify champions, surface skeptics, assess political reality inside a prospect, and avoid false-positive deal momentum.
  • Strong commercial instincts and comfort with pricing, packaging, and proposal nuance, especially when enterprise firms need tailored economics or phased solutions.
  • High emotional intelligence and strong executive presence. You can push a deal forward without becoming pushy, and you know how to balance confidence with honesty when the answer is not yet fully defined.
  • Strong cross-functional leadership without relying on formal authority. You can keep internal partners aligned, informed, and focused on what matters most to win the deal the right way.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ication, with disciplined follow-through on notes, next steps, and internal/external expectations.
  • Comfort working inside a collaborative structure where success depends on communication, role clarity, and shared ownership rather than isolated heroics.
  • SIE, Series 7, and Series 63 licenses, or the ability to obtain them within 90 days of employment.

What you need to know about the Seattle Tech Scene

Home to tech titans like Microsoft and Amazon, Seattle punches far above its weight in innovation. But its surrounding mountains, sprinkled with world-famous hiking trails and climbing routes, make the city a destination for outdoorsy types as well. Established as a logging town before shifting to shipbuilding and logistics, the Emerald City is now known for its contributions to aerospace, software, biotech and cloud computing. And its status as a thriving tech ecosystem is attracting out-of-town companies looking to establish new tech and engineering hubs.

Key Facts About Seattle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 287,000; 13%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Amazon, Microsoft, Meta, Google
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, software, biotechnology, game development
  • Funding Landscape: $3.1 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Madrona, Fuse, Tola, Maveron
  • Research Centers and Universities: University of Washington, Seattle University, Seattle Pacific University, Allen Institute for Brain Science,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ation, Seattle Children’s Research Institute
